    70E Reading (S.R.) from 1948 to December,1962.
    70E Salisbury from December,1962 to July,1967. <BJ>

    There were three (3) trains operating at the Bluebell today.

    No.672 "Fenchurch" was working the scheduled Bluebell 'Spring Special', and the hired-in Class 08 diesel locomotive No.13236 was busy at Kingscote and Imberhorne Lane on the northern extension with an engineering train. But the most spectacular working was, without a doubt, SR class Battle of Britain, No. 34059 "Sir Archibald Sinclair" working a Special.
